火山引擎對象存儲的批量刪除操作及高效文件管理策略
火山引擎對象存儲是否支持批量刪除?
火山引擎對象存儲(TOS,Toutiao Object Storage)作為字節(jié)跳動旗下的云存儲服務(wù),提供了完善的批量刪除功能。通過控制臺頁面、API/SDK接口或命令行工具toscli,用戶均可實(shí)現(xiàn)高效的多文件刪除操作。
典型批量刪除方式包括:
- 控制臺操作:勾選多個文件后一鍵刪除
- API調(diào)用:通過DeleteMultipleObjects接口批量處理
- 生命周期規(guī)則:設(shè)置過期自動刪除策略
- SDK支持:各語言SDK提供批量刪除方法
高效管理大量文件的五大策略
1. 利用分層存儲架構(gòu)
火山引擎TOS提供標(biāo)準(zhǔn)、低頻、歸檔三種存儲類型,支持自動分層策略。通過將訪問頻率低的文件自動轉(zhuǎn)為低頻或歸檔存儲,可降低50%-70%存儲成本。
2. 智能生命周期管理
可配置規(guī)則實(shí)現(xiàn)自動化管理:
example:30天未訪問轉(zhuǎn)為低頻存儲 → 1年后自動歸檔 → 5年后自動刪除
3. 使用目錄化組織策略
推薦目錄結(jié)構(gòu)示例:
/業(yè)務(wù)組/項(xiàng)目ID/年/月/日/文件
配合ListObjects接口的prefix參數(shù)可高效檢索
4. 批量操作工具鏈
火山引擎提供完整工具支持:
- toscli命令行工具
- 批量處理SDK(Python/Java/Go等)
- 控制臺批量任務(wù)管理
5. 監(jiān)控與數(shù)據(jù)分析
通過控制臺可查看:
- 存儲量趨勢圖表
- 熱點(diǎn)文件分析
- 訪問頻次統(tǒng)計(jì)

火山引擎對象存儲的核心優(yōu)勢
| 優(yōu)勢維度 | 具體表現(xiàn) |
|---|---|
| 性能表現(xiàn) | 單bucket支持百億級文件,99.95%的可用性保證 |
| 成本優(yōu)化 | 按需計(jì)費(fèi)+智能分層,綜合成本比傳統(tǒng)方案低30%+ |
| 安全性 | 服務(wù)端加密+細(xì)粒度權(quán)限控制+操作審計(jì)日志 |
| 生態(tài)整合 | 無縫對接火山引擎大數(shù)據(jù)、cdn、容器服務(wù)等產(chǎn)品 |
典型應(yīng)用場景
視頻處理場景
原始視頻 → 轉(zhuǎn)碼處理 → 分發(fā)存儲 → 冷備份
通過生命周期規(guī)則自動管理各階段文件
大數(shù)據(jù)分析
日志文件 → 批量上傳 → EMR處理 → 結(jié)果歸檔
利用前綴檢索和分批處理提高效率
總結(jié)
火山引擎對象存儲通過原生的批量刪除功能和智能文件管理能力,為企業(yè)級用戶提供了高效、可靠的存儲解決方案。其核心優(yōu)勢體現(xiàn)在:
1)完善的批量操作接口和工具鏈支持;
2)創(chuàng)新的存儲分層和生命周期管理機(jī)制;
3)與云計(jì)算生態(tài)的深度整合。
針對海量文件管理場景,建議采用"存儲分層+目錄優(yōu)化+自動化策略"的組合方案,配合監(jiān)控系統(tǒng)持續(xù)優(yōu)化?;鹕揭鎀OS在保持高性能訪問的同時,能有效控制存儲成本,特別適合需要處理PB級數(shù)據(jù)的企業(yè)用戶。

kf@jusoucn.com
4008-020-360


4008-020-360
